Lil’ Wayne pleads not guilty to gun charges in New York

Rapper Lil’ Wayne has appeared at an arraignment hearing in New York, pleading not guilty to gun charges.

He was in court yesterday facing two felony charges of criminal possession of a weapon in the second degree.

The charges stem from an incident last July when police found a handfun stashed in his tour bus, following a performance with Ja Rule.

If convicted, he faces up to three-and-a-hald years in prison due to the city’s strict gun laws.

And to add more legal trouble, he is also facing drugs and weapons charges in Arizona after a border patrol inspection of his tour bus allegedly revealed marijuana, cocaine, ecstasy and drug paraphernalia as well as a 40-caliber pistol.
